A heavy, geometric sans with broad proportions and a smooth, rounded construction. Curves are built from near-circular bowls and open apertures, while straight strokes stay crisp with minimal modulation. Terminals are mostly blunt and clean, with subtly softened corners that keep the texture friendly rather than severe. The lowercase shows single-storey forms (notably a and g) and compact counters that hold up well at large display sizes; numerals follow the same robust, rounded logic with simple, readable shapes.

Best suited to headlines and short-to-medium display copy where its mass and broad forms can deliver strong presence. It also fits branding, packaging, and signage that benefit from a clean, friendly geometric voice and high visual impact at larger sizes.

The overall tone is approachable and contemporary, projecting confidence without feeling aggressive. Its rounded geometry and generous forms give it a warm, slightly playful character that still reads as professional and straightforward.

The design appears aimed at a contemporary geometric sans optimized for bold communication: simple, rounded letterforms, sturdy strokes, and a welcoming texture that reads quickly in display settings.

Spacing reads even and calm in the sample text, producing a dense, poster-like color. The shapes favor clarity and impact over delicacy, with consistent joins and interior spaces that maintain a stable rhythm across mixed-case settings.
